Starting with the new PGYTECH Camera Strap Pro, this versatile and professional-grade camera strap is designed to meet the needs of photographers and videographers. The ergonomic design ensures comfort during long shoots, thanks to a 60mm wide shoulder pad with triple cushioning and a soft suede lining that offers a secure, non-slip grip. Built to handle the demands of heavy equipment, the strap supports a remarkable load capacity of up to 90kg (198.4 lbs), thanks to its high-strength materials, including UHMWPE cord. The innovative three-layer wear indicator adds an extra layer of safety by visually signalling when the strap needs replacement. Additionally, the patented anti-loosening design of the quick-release plate ensures your camera remains securely fastened, even under challenging conditions.

The Camera Strap Pro is fully adjustable, with a range of 83 to 145cm (32.6 to 57 in), catering to users of different heights. Its versatile configuration allows for both crossbody and shoulder carry, while the detachable underarm strap provides triple-point stability during motion shots. Compatibility with most mirrorless and DSLR cameras ensures it suits a wide range of equipment, and a built-in D-ring adds extra utility for attaching small accessories.

Now, onto the PGYTECH Camera Strap Master, designed to meet the needs of professional photographers across a range of scenarios, from wildlife photography to weddings and events. Its multi-gear support allows you to carry up to three cameras with telephoto, zoom, or prime lenses, providing hands-free convenience and faster workflow. Whether you’re capturing fleeting moments in nature or switching between portraits and group shots, this strap ensures you stay ready.

The quick-release functionality with a built-in safety lock lets you move your camera into position swiftly and securely, while the auto-locking mechanism prevents accidental detachment. Built to handle up to 90kg (198.4 lbs) of load, it’s crafted from high-strength materials, making it suitable for heavy gear. Plus, the three-layer wear indicator gives you a visual cue for maintenance, so safety is never compromised.

Designed with comfort in mind, the 60mm ergonomic shoulder pad evenly distributes weight for extended shoots, while triple cushioning and soft suede lining ensure a comfortable fit all day. The adjustable range of 83 to 145cm (32.6 to 57 in) and the AutoFit shoulder system adapt to different body types, providing a tailored feel. Additional features like expansion straps, a detachable chest strap, and D-ring clips add even more versatility to your setup.
